Iowa Code § 455B.485

Powers and duties of the commission

The commission shall:

1. Establish policy for the implementation of this part.

2. Adopt, modify, or repeal rules necessary to implement this part pursuant to chapter 17A.

3. Approve the budget request for administration of this part prior to submission to the department of management. The commission may increase, decrease, or strike any proposed expenditure within the budget request before granting approval.
4. Recommend legislative action which may be required for the safe and proper management of waste, for the acquisition or operation of a facility, for the funding of a facility, to enter into interstate agreements for the management of a facility, and to improve the operation of the department relating to waste management assistance.

5. Approve all contracts and agreements, in excess of twenty-five thousand dollars, under this part between the department and other public or private persons or agencies.

87 Acts, ch 180, §7; 92 Acts, ch 1239, §21; 2001 Acts, ch 7, §10; 2002 Acts, ch 1162, §53; 2013 Acts, ch 12, §7
